Transaction d052de0262e3f2b9d109b7486b1fd010c9980c8c2e71d4d8657d36daf6533ade

1 Input
2 Outputs
  • d052de0262e3f2b9d109b7486b1fd010c9980c8c2e71d4d8657d36daf6533ade:0
  • value  17684829723
    address  17dfXn8zXhzFSjrhdDPKJzQgehYga7srjf
  • d052de0262e3f2b9d109b7486b1fd010c9980c8c2e71d4d8657d36daf6533ade:1
  • value  7250000
    address  3QbWP7sa3qo4uFL9vitHG8moCpkvKMQkqo